House Priceson Marden Close

Sale prices range from £293,887 for 3 bedroom leasehold houses with a garden (710 ft2) to £407,626 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(796 ft2) .

Monthly rental prices range from £1,790 pcm for 3 bed houses to £2,252 pcm for 3 bed houses.

The gross rental yield is between 6.3% and 7.3%.

The average value per square foot is £403.

Sales History
on Marden Close, Brighton, BN2

The last sale was on 25th June 2025 for £302,000 and since then the market in the area has decreased by 2.9%. The street has had a total of 20 sales since 1995.

Marden Close, Brighton, BN2 has seen 5 sales in the last three years and 1 sale in the last twelve months.
